Default please add intelligent speedup/down detection

in my dvbv media center i normally have the following framerates:

24p for hd or ntsc movies
25p for movies and tv
50p for hdtv (720p@50fps)

now i set reclock to "25p (locked)" so 24p always gets upsampled to 25p and frames matches my tvs 50hz.

the problem is that now hd tv (720p@50fps) gets speeddown to 25fps too.

please add an option to ignore very big changes of the fps.
maybe with values that a user can set.
something like "only speedup/speeddown when difference is xx fps"
so when i enter "2 fps" 24 to 25 will work and 50 to 25 gets ignored.

or when "locked" is enabled you have an extra option called "ignore double rate framerates".
so when a 48, 50 or 60 fps stream is found it doesnt do a speeddown.

or just add "NTSC SpeedUp (force to 25fps)"
so when 24p or 23,976 is found it does an automatic speedup to 25fps.

Hallo wedok!

Are you sure it's 50p and not 50i deinterlaced to 25p?
You can also choose "Automatic" instead of "25p (locked)" and set how many percent of speedup/down you want to allow in the ReClock settings.

Quote:
and set how many percent of speedup/down you want to allow in the ReClock settings.
thx.
that was it.
increased from 1% to 10% and now 24p plays @ 25fps when set to "auto (best)"
